To retain the Accessibility I have been inform you need to do the following.
File>Save & Send>Create PDF/XPS Document I check the right boxes in the options; "Document structure tags for Accessibility" To transfer the Alt Text for Accessibility issues, this has been the primary way to go by this listed on the web.
